RE: Delimited list problems - a bug?

2007-01-26 Thread Ian Skinner
If I am explicitly telling CF that the delimiter is two pipes, why would it stop when finding only one? I tried this with other delimiters and found the same behavior. Am I crazy or does this appear to be a bug? NOPE, it is not a bug but defiantly not an intuitive way for this to work.

RE: Delimited list problems - a bug?

2007-01-26 Thread Everett, Al \(NIH/NIGMS\) [C]
Sure. Replace the substring that you want to use as a list delimiter with a single character, then do your list operation. For the single character, be careful to use something that's unlikely to be in your data already. I like to use a non-printable character for this, like the Bell character
